ICD-10: H53.139
Sudden visual loss, unspecified eye

Clinical Description
Definition
Sudden visual loss is characterized by a rapid decline in vision that occurs within a short time frame, typically defined as less than 24 hours. This condition can be alarming for patients and may indicate underlying serious medical issues.
Symptoms
Patients with sudden visual loss may present with various symptoms, including:
- Complete or partial loss of vision in one or both eyes.
- Distorted vision or visual field defects.
- Associated symptoms such as eye pain, headache, or flashes of light.
- Possible changes in color perception.
Etiology
The causes of sudden visual loss can be diverse and may include:
- Retinal Detachment: A condition where the retina separates from the back of the eye, leading to vision loss.
- Vitreous Hemorrhage: Bleeding into the vitreous humor can obscure vision.
- Central Retinal Artery Occlusion (CRAO): A blockage of the central retinal artery, often resulting in sudden vision loss.
- Central Retinal Vein Occlusion (CRVO): A blockage of the central retinal vein, which can also lead to sudden visual impairment.
- Optic Neuritis: Inflammation of the optic nerve, often associated with multiple sclerosis.
- Transient Ischemic Attack (TIA): A temporary decrease in blood flow to the brain, which can affect vision.
Diagnosis
Diagnosis of sudden visual loss typically involves:
- Patient History: Gathering information about the onset, duration, and nature of the visual loss.
- Ophthalmic Examination: A thorough eye examination, including visual acuity tests and fundoscopic examination to assess the retina and optic nerve.
- Imaging Studies: In some cases, imaging such as optical coherence tomography (OCT) or fluorescein angiography may be necessary to evaluate the retina and blood vessels.
Management
Management of sudden visual loss depends on the underlying cause:
- Referral to Specialists: Patients may need to be referred to ophthalmologists or neurologists for further evaluation and treatment.
- Surgical Interventions: Conditions like retinal detachment may require surgical repair.
- Medical Treatment: Conditions such as optic neuritis may be treated with corticosteroids.

Clinical Presentation
Definition and Context
Sudden visual loss is characterized by a rapid decline in vision, which can occur in one or both eyes. This condition may manifest as complete or partial loss of vision and can be associated with various etiologies, including retinal detachment, vitreous hemorrhage, or ischemic optic neuropathy. The unspecified nature of H53.139 indicates that the exact cause of the visual loss has not been determined at the time of coding.
Onset
The onset of sudden visual loss is typically abrupt, often described by patients as occurring within seconds to minutes. This rapid change can be alarming and may prompt immediate medical attention.
Signs and Symptoms
Common Symptoms
Patients presenting with sudden visual loss may report a variety of symptoms, including:
- Blurred Vision: A common initial complaint, where objects appear out of focus.
- Darkening or Shadowing: Patients may describe a shadow or curtain effect over their vision.
- Flashes of Light: Some individuals experience photopsia, or flashes of light, particularly if there is retinal involvement.
- Floaters: The presence of spots or floaters in the visual field can accompany sudden visual loss, often indicating vitreous changes.
- Complete Vision Loss: In severe cases, patients may experience total loss of vision in the affected eye.
Associated Signs
Upon examination, healthcare providers may observe:
- Pupil Reactions: Abnormal pupillary responses, such as a relative afferent pupillary defect (RAPD), may indicate optic nerve involvement.
- Fundoscopic Findings: Depending on the underlying cause, findings may include retinal hemorrhages, detachment, or signs of ischemia.
- Visual Field Deficits: Testing may reveal specific visual field losses, which can help localize the problem.
Patient Characteristics
Demographics
Sudden visual loss can affect individuals across various demographics, but certain characteristics may increase risk:
- Age: Older adults are more susceptible to conditions leading to sudden visual loss, such as retinal detachment or vascular occlusions.
- Medical History: Patients with a history of diabetes, hypertension, or cardiovascular disease may be at higher risk for ischemic causes of visual loss.
- Lifestyle Factors: Smoking and sedentary lifestyle can contribute to vascular health, impacting the risk of sudden visual loss.
Risk Factors
Several risk factors are associated with sudden visual loss, including:
- Previous Eye Conditions: A history of eye diseases, such as glaucoma or cataracts, may predispose individuals to sudden changes in vision.
- Trauma: Recent eye trauma or surgery can lead to sudden visual loss due to complications.
- Systemic Conditions: Conditions like hypertension and diabetes can lead to vascular changes affecting the eyes.

Treatment Guidelines
Sudden visual loss, classified under ICD-10 code H53.139, refers to a rapid decline in vision that occurs unexpectedly and can affect one or both eyes. This condition can arise from various underlying causes, necessitating a comprehensive approach to diagnosis and treatment. Below, we explore standard treatment approaches for this condition, including diagnostic evaluations, potential causes, and management strategies.
Diagnostic Evaluation
Before initiating treatment, a thorough diagnostic evaluation is essential to determine the underlying cause of sudden visual loss. Common diagnostic procedures include:
- Comprehensive Eye Examination: This includes visual acuity tests, pupil response assessments, and examination of the anterior and posterior segments of the eye using slit-lamp biomicroscopy and ophthalmoscopy.
- Imaging Studies: Optical coherence tomography (OCT) and fundus photography may be employed to visualize retinal structures and identify abnormalities.
- Visual Field Testing: This helps assess the extent of vision loss and can indicate specific types of visual field defects.
- Blood Tests: These may be necessary to rule out systemic conditions such as diabetes or autoimmune diseases that could contribute to visual loss.
- Referral to Specialists: Depending on initial findings, referrals to neurologists or other specialists may be warranted for further evaluation, especially if a neurological cause is suspected.
Common Causes and Corresponding Treatments
The treatment for sudden visual loss largely depends on its underlying cause. Here are some common causes and their respective management strategies:
1. Retinal Detachment
- Treatment: Surgical intervention is often required, which may include procedures such as pneumatic retinopexy, scleral buckle, or vitrectomy, depending on the severity and type of detachment.
2. Vitreous Hemorrhage
- Treatment: Observation may be sufficient if the hemorrhage is minor. However, if vision does not improve, a vitrectomy may be necessary to remove the blood from the vitreous cavity.
3. Central Retinal Artery Occlusion (CRAO)
- Treatment: Immediate treatment options may include ocular massage, anterior chamber paracentesis, or medications to lower intraocular pressure. Unfortunately, the prognosis for vision recovery is often poor.
4. Central Retinal Vein Occlusion (CRVO)
- Treatment: Management may involve intravitreal injections of anti-VEGF (vascular endothelial growth factor) agents or corticosteroids to reduce macular edema.
5. Optic Neuritis
- Treatment: High-dose corticosteroids are typically administered to reduce inflammation and improve vision recovery.
6. Transient Ischemic Attack (TIA) or Stroke
- Treatment: Immediate medical intervention is critical, often involving antiplatelet therapy, anticoagulants, or surgical procedures to restore blood flow.
7. Infectious Causes (e.g., Endophthalmitis)
- Treatment: Intravitreal antibiotics or antifungals may be necessary, along with systemic medications depending on the infection's nature.
General Management Strategies
In addition to specific treatments based on the underlying cause, general management strategies for patients experiencing sudden visual loss may include:
- Patient Education: Informing patients about the importance of early detection and treatment of eye conditions.
- Follow-Up Care: Regular follow-up appointments to monitor vision changes and treatment efficacy.
- Supportive Care: Providing resources for low vision rehabilitation if permanent vision loss occurs.

Diagnostic Criteria
The ICD-10 code H53.139 refers to "Sudden visual loss, unspecified eye." Diagnosing this condition involves a comprehensive evaluation that includes clinical history, physical examination, and possibly additional diagnostic tests. Below are the key criteria and considerations used in the diagnosis of sudden visual loss:
Clinical History
- Symptom Onset: The patient should report a sudden onset of visual loss, which is typically defined as occurring within a few hours to a few days.
- Duration: Understanding how long the visual loss has persisted is crucial. Sudden visual loss that lasts more than 24 hours may indicate a more serious underlying condition.
- Associated Symptoms: The presence of other symptoms such as pain, flashes of light, floaters, or visual field defects can provide important diagnostic clues.
Physical Examination
- Visual Acuity Testing: A thorough assessment of visual acuity is essential. This may involve using a Snellen chart or other visual acuity tests to quantify the degree of vision loss.
- Pupil Examination: Checking for relative afferent pupillary defect (RAPD) can help differentiate between various causes of visual loss.
- Fundoscopic Examination: A detailed examination of the retina and optic nerve head can reveal signs of retinal detachment, hemorrhage, or other abnormalities.
Diagnostic Tests
- Imaging Studies: Depending on the clinical findings, imaging studies such as optical coherence tomography (OCT), fluorescein angiography, or MRI may be warranted to assess for structural abnormalities.
- Blood Tests: Laboratory tests may be performed to rule out systemic conditions that could contribute to visual loss, such as diabetes or hypertension.
- Visual Field Testing: This can help identify specific patterns of visual loss that may indicate particular conditions affecting the optic nerve or retina.
Differential Diagnosis
It is essential to consider and rule out various potential causes of sudden visual loss, including:
- Retinal Detachment: Often presents with sudden visual loss and may be accompanied by flashes or floaters.
- Vitreous Hemorrhage: Can cause sudden vision changes, often seen in patients with diabetes or trauma.
- Central Retinal Artery Occlusion (CRAO): Typically presents with sudden, painless vision loss.
- Central Retinal Vein Occlusion (CRVO): May cause sudden vision loss, often with a history of vascular risk factors.
- Optic Neuritis: Often associated with pain and may occur in younger patients, particularly those with multiple sclerosis.
